ZNB0001 | Minimum 100K required for NATURAL V2 buffer - disabled |
Explanation: |
Natural Version 2 requires a buffer size of at least 100k to function. The specified Natural buffer was smaller than 100k. |
System action: |
Procesing continues without any Natural Version 2 buffer pool. |
System programmer info: |
If a Natural Version 2 buffer pool is required, insure that at least 100k is allocated to it. |
ZNB0002 | Minimum 10 directories required for NATURAL V2 buffer - disabled |
Explanation: |
Natural Version 2 requires at least 10 directory entries to function correctly. Less than 10 entries have been specified in the Com-plete sysparms. |
System action: |
Processing continues without a Natural Version 2 buffer pool. |
System programmer info: |
If a Natural Version 2 buffer pool is required, insure that at least 10 directory entries are specified in the Com-plete sysparms. |
ZNB0003 | No room to allocate NATURAL V2 buffer directories - disabled |
Explanation: |
The Natural Buffer Pool Manager has not been able to allocate space for the Natural Buffer Pool directory entries. |
System action: |
Processing continues without a Natural Version 2 buffer pool. |
System programmer info: |
As the directory entries are suballocated from the total size specified for the Natural Buffer pool, insure that at least enough storage exists in the Natural Buffer Pool to contain the required number of entries. |
ZNB0004 | Not anough storage for NATURAL V2 buffer - disabled |
Explanation: |
The Natural Buffer Pool Manager attempted to get the specified storage for the Natural buffer pool and failed. |
System action: |
Processing continues without a Natural Version 2 buffer. |
System programmer info: |
Insure that the size of the buffer is correctly specified and if so, insure that the necessary storage is available for the buffer at initialisation time. |
ZNB0005 | NATURAL V2 buffer inactive |
Explanation: |
The Natural Version 2 Buffer Pool is not active for this Com-plete . |
ZNB0006 | NATURAL V2 BUFFER TEXTLEN must be 1K, 2K or 4K - disabled |
Explanation: |
The Natural Version 2 buffer pool text sizes must be one of the listed values. In this case, a values other than one of those listed was specified in the Com-plete sysparms. |
System action: |
Processing continues without a Natural Version 2 buffer pool. |
System programmer info: |
When specifing the text length for the Natural Version 2 buffer pool, insure that the size specified is one of the valid sizes. |

ZNB3001 | No local buffer pools allocated for NATURAL |
Explanation: |
The Natural local buffer pool status command BPSTAT has been issued from the operator console. Currently no Local Buffer Pools are active. Either Natural is using global buffer pools only or no Natural session has been started yet. |
System action: |
None. |
ZNB3002 | $1 $2 |
Explanation: |
The Natural local buffer pool status command BPSTAT has been issued from the operator console. A header line followed by one or more local buffer pool status lines showing the buffer pool type, size in KB, storage address and length are displayed. $1 shows the server name (NCFNAT41). Example: NCFNAT41 **** NATURAL LOCAL BUFFER POOLS ALLOCATED **** NCFNAT41 TYPE=NAT SIZE=1024 A=1061C000 L=00100000 NCFNAT41 TYPE=EDIT SIZE=500 A=17D20000 L=0007D000 |
System action: |
None. |
